Raw Materials, QA/QC
Nickel, cobalt, and zirconinum alloys
- Fast light element analysis, including silicon for Ni alloys
- High throughput with Axon Technology™
- Vanta VCR model for light elements
- Vanta VLW model for basic grade ID
Stainless and low-alloy steels
- Accurate silicon, phosphorus, and sulfur analysis
- High throughput with Axon Technology™
- Vanta VCR model for light elements
- Vanta VLW model for basic grade ID
Titanium alloys
- Rapid aluminum capability in titanium alloys
- High throughput with Axon Technology™
- Vanta VCR model recommended
Aluminum alloys, brasses, and bronzes
- Rapid magnesium in aluminum verification
- Accurate aluminum and silicon in brasses and bronzes
- High throughput with Axon Technology™
- Vanta VCR model recommended
